India’s IT sector: No festive spark in Q2, macro headwinds weigh heavily on growth
🕒 1 min read
India’s IT services sector anticipates modest Q2 2025 results due to macroeconomic uncertainty and client caution. While Tier-I firms like Infosys and HCLTech show slight growth, mid-tier companies are set to outperform. Margins remain steady, but GenAI’s deflationary impact and vertical headwinds pose challenges.
